Some raise concerns over former teachers union members seeking Downers Grove school board seats
A former teachers union member is joining two former teachers union presidents in bids for seats on the seven-member Downers Grove Grade School District 58 School Board.
-
Teacher's union members vying for control of Downers Grove school board
Two former teachers’ union presidents have launched campaigns to capture seats on the Downers Grove Grade School District 58 school board.
